
The largest portion of this sum – around 50 million lei – was authorised by the AIPA agency as state financial aid to 333 agricultural producers whose farmland was severely affected by the drought in 2025.
In addition, a significant sum – 22.30 million lei – was approved for payment under the LEADER rural community development programme. These funds were channelled towards the development of 218 investment projects, mainly (185 projects) in the public sector: administrative and economic activities and support services, public administration, water supply, sewerage, waste management, education, construction, etc. This source also funded 24 business projects (totalling 1.78 million lei) in agriculture and forestry, the processing industry and tourism.
In August, the AIPA agency approved nearly 7 million lei in post-investment subsidies (partial cost reimbursement) for three applications from beneficiaries in the agri-food sector (livestock farming, viticulture and winemaking).
A further just over 3 million lei were received in August by two livestock farms – in the form of advance payments.
